Abstract

The utility model relates to an extruder cooling water treatment device, including cooling bath, gas washing case, vacuum pump and catch water, the discharge gate of the one end intercommunication extruder of cooling bath, the air inlet of gas washing case is connected with the gas vent of extruder, and the gas vent of gas washing case is connected with the air inlet of vacuum pump, the gas vent of vacuum pump and catch water's access connection, the working solution entry of vacuum pump is connected with the delivery port of cooling bath, catch water's delivery port is connected with the water inlet of the working solution of vacuum pump entry or cooling bath. The utility model discloses a volatility gas that the gas washing case was taken out in to the extruder is handled, has absorbed the volatility harmful gas in the extruder, prevents the exhaust pollution environment, simultaneously through vacuum pump and catch water in with the cooling bath discharged water cyclic utilization get up, reach the using water wisely, reduce discharging fall can the purpose.

Background technology
Extruder is made it by plastic heating in glutinous stream mode, when pressurizeing, make it to be become by tool effigurate mouth mould cross section and the similar non-individual body of Oral incision then by cooling, the plastics with certain geometrical shape and size are made to become elastomeric state from viscous state, last cooling and shaping is glassy state, obtains required goods.From the high-temperature molding product that extruding dies is extruded, just can reach normal temperature after having to pass through cooling system cooling, otherwise can deform under gravity.Being generally carry out cooling products by being arranged on the cooling bath after extruding dies now, directly can discharging after the water cooling product in existing cooling bath, not only causing the waste of water resource, also increase production cost.
Utility model content
For solving the problem, the utility model provides a kind of cooling water of extruding machine treating apparatus of more environmental protection.
The technical scheme realizing the utility model object is: a kind of cooling water of extruding machine treating apparatus, comprises cooling bath, gas washing case, vavuum pump and steam-water separator; One end of described cooling bath is communicated with the discharging opening of extruder; The described air inlet of gas washing case is connected with the exhaust outlet of extruder, and the exhaust outlet of gas washing case is connected with the air inlet of vavuum pump; The exhaust outlet of described vavuum pump is connected with the import of steam-water separator, and the working solution entrance of vavuum pump is connected with the delivery port of cooling bath; The delivery port of described steam-water separator is connected with the water inlet of the working solution entrance of vavuum pump or cooling bath.
Described cooling water of extruding machine treating apparatus also comprises recovery tank; The water inlet of described recovery tank is connected with the delivery port of steam-water separator, and the delivery port of recovery tank is connected with the water inlet of the working solution entrance of vavuum pump or cooling bath.
The working solution inlet pipeline of described vavuum pump is provided with filter.
The utility model has positive effect: (1) gas washing case of the present utility model processes the escaping gas extracted out in extruder, absorbs the volatile harmful gas in extruder, prevents exhaust emission environment; Simultaneously by the water circulation use that vavuum pump and steam-water separator will be discharged in cooling bath, reach using water wisely, reduce discharging the object of falling energy.
(2) water inlet of recovery tank of the present utility model is connected with the delivery port of steam-water separator, delivery port is connected with the working solution entrance of vavuum pump or the water inlet of cooling bath, set up recovery tank in systems in which, cooling water can have been stored as his use, use more flexible.
(3) the working solution inlet pipeline of the vavuum pump of the utility model cooling water of extruding machine treating apparatus is provided with filter, and preventing from having cooled in the cooling water of product has foreign matters from being blocked pipeline and equipment, enhances the protection to whole device.

Detailed description of the invention
(embodiment 1)
See Fig. 1, a kind of cooling water of extruding machine treating apparatus of the present embodiment, comprises cooling bath 2, gas washing case 3, vavuum pump 4, steam-water separator 5 and recovery tank 6.
One end of cooling bath 2 is communicated with the discharging opening of extruder 1.The air inlet of gas washing case 3 is connected with the exhaust outlet of extruder 1, and the exhaust outlet of gas washing case 3 is connected with the air inlet of vavuum pump 4.The exhaust outlet of vavuum pump 4 is connected with the import of steam-water separator 5.The water inlet of recovery tank 6 is connected with the delivery port of steam-water separator 5, and the delivery port of recovery tank 6 is connected with the water inlet of cooling bath 2.The working solution inlet pipeline of vavuum pump 4 is provided with filter 7.
The cooling water of extruding machine treating apparatus job step of the present embodiment is as follows: the high-temperature molding product cooling that cooling water is extruded extruder 1 discharging opening is rear just by the delivery port inflow vavuum pump 2 of cooling bath 2, vavuum pump 2 extracts the volatile materials in extruder 1 simultaneously, volatile materials is drawn in vavuum pump 2 after cleaning in gas washing case 3, steam mixes in vavuum pump 2, drain into steam-water separator 5 from exhaust outlet to be separated, water after separation is delivered to recovery tank 6, the water inlet of the water outlet conveying cooling bath 2 of recovery tank 6, forms a circulation.
(embodiment 2)
See Fig. 2, the present embodiment is substantially the same manner as Example 1, and difference is: the delivery port of recovery tank 6 is connected with the working solution entrance of vavuum pump 3.
The cooling water of extruding machine treating apparatus job step of the present embodiment is as follows: the high-temperature molding product cooling that cooling water is extruded extruder 1 discharging opening is rear just by the delivery port inflow vavuum pump 2 of cooling bath 2, vavuum pump 2 extracts the volatile materials in extruder 1 simultaneously, volatile materials is drawn in vavuum pump 2 after cleaning in gas washing case 3, steam mixes in vavuum pump 2, drain into steam-water separator 5 from exhaust outlet to be separated, water after separation is delivered to recovery tank 6, the working solution entrance of the water outlet conveying vavuum pump 3 of recovery tank 6, forms a circulation.
